Solution Overview

Problem

Existing outlet elements in sanitary fittings fail to efficiently seal transitions between the base element and the valve device, particularly when switching between different water guides.

Innovation Solution

The base element incorporates a sealing element and a seal receptacle that ensures a reliable seal between the downstream outlet openings and upstream inlet openings of the switched water guides in each switching position, using a design that accommodates the sealing element to move into different positions as the valve device is adjusted.

AI summary

The invention relates to an improvement in the field of sanitary engineering. It discloses an outlet element (1) for a sanitary fitting which comprises a base element (2) and a valve device (3) which is connected to the base element (2) and can be adjusted relative to the base element (2) between at least two switching positions for switching over between at least two separate water conduits (4, 5). In order to seal a passage between an outlet opening (6) of the base element (2) on the outflow side and at least one inlet opening (7, 8) of a connected water conduit (4, 5) on the inflow side, the base element (2) has a sealing element (9) which in each of the at least two switching positions is designed to seal the relevant passage between an outlet opening (6) of the base element (2) on the outflow side and the at least one inlet opening (7, 8) of the connected water conduit (4, 5) on the inflow side.
